AI voice cloning creates a voice style from a sample so you can generate consistent voiceover audio.
This is the safest intended use: use your own voice or a voice you have explicit permission to use.
No. Do not clone voices without consent, and avoid impersonation, deception, or misleading uses.
Common uses include creator voiceovers, lesson narration, draft scripts, localization review, and internal demos.
Voice cloning can be used with voiceover generation, but the key feature is creating a consistent voice style from an authorized sample.
Avoid exact-match promises. Output quality depends on the sample, script, and current product capabilities.
Teams can prepare consistent training narration when they have proper rights to the voice being used.
Voice cloning can fit alongside other MusicRemover.ai workflows for preparing voice-focused content.
Use a clear authorized sample, write natural scripts, and review the generated audio before publishing.
Confirm consent, usage rights, current product limits, supported formats, and any disclosure requirements for your project.
